The Grande Prairie RCMP is searching for a suspect that tried to rob a convenience store early Tuesday morning.
Police say the man went into the convenience store on 100 Street and 105 Avenue just after 3 a.m.
He asked the employee to open the till and give him the money. The clerk instead called police and the man ran to the back of the store.
The suspect is approximately 5’5’’, has tattoos on both his arms and short, blondish/grayish hair and a moustache. His index finger on his right hand is amputated.
He was wearing a black AC/DC t-shirt and black shorts at the time. The man also has stuttered speech.
